Georgian Coast Guard law enforcement tactical group to participate in NATO Maritime Security Mission

Members of the Coast Guard Department’s Law Enforcement Tactical Group of the Georgian Border Police, under the Ministry of Internal Affairs, will participate in NATO’s maritime security operation, “Operation SEA GUARDIAN.”

Davit Tamazashvili, Chief of the Border Police, saw off 12 members of the Tactical Group at Shota Rustaveli Tbilisi International Airport. He wished the team success and reiterated that this marks the third time Georgia’s unit has been involved as an operational partner in the NATO-led Maritime Security Operation under the auspices of the North Atlantic Alliance.
